      Coalition shows how public can help
            As a college student studying both Earth and political science, I have come to understand the power residents have to impact their local environment. New Jersey currently has over 20,000 toxic waste sites, the most of any state in the nation. If left unremediated or undetected, toxic sites will threaten human health and the surrounding ecosystems.

      Student praises passage of Medicare act
            I recently attended an event at the AARP New Jersey State Office regarding the recent passage of the Medicare Improvements for Patients and Providers Act. All 15 New Jersey delegates voted in favor of the bill, which will help America's seniors, doctors and taxpayers. Congressmen Frank Pallone and Rush Holt attended to event to celebrate the passage of this important bill.

      Government's limiting of rights is offensive to all
            The Supreme Court recently declared the Washington, D.C., gun ban unconstitutional and in the process made it clear that the rights identified in the Second Amendment were rights of the individual, just like the rights identified in the First Amendment.
